Here's a little behind-the-scenes look at a new item is currently in development. What you see here doesn't represent the final design, but part of our process is to prototype products first before we do an official release. The mockup shown above helps us to visualize the final piece, but we always start with artwork done in a vector illustration app. This allows us to play with the sizing and colors before making final changes.
We then like to do a test print on an actual garment, to get a better sense of what is working or not working. We can fine tune the sizing and position of the graphics, and add unique features such as custom labels or tag prints. Having a prototype also gives us a chance to check the quality and feel of the fabric. In this case, this hoodie is a blend of 80% cotton and 20% polyester. We also test fit the hoodie for a sizing check to determine if this is a classic, slim, or relaxed fit.
Once all the details are finalized for the graphic design, garment, material, labels, and other features we can then move into our production process where we can produce the shirts, hoodies, and accessories for all the ADV Addicts out there.
